银行卡二三四要素验证接口-在线银行卡二三四要素验证-银行卡二三四要素验证API

接口简介:全面覆盖,支持所有带银联标识的银行卡;

高准确性-验证结果实时返回,准确率达99%;

银行卡二要素若是手机号+卡号,不支持工商和农商行

接口地址:https://www.wapi.cn/api_detail/102/235.html

在线核验:https://www.wapi.cn/bank_name_verfiy.html

网站地址:https://www.wapi.cn

返回格式:json,xml,jsonp调用

请求方式:GET,POST

POST 请求需要设置Header头:Content-Type: application/x-www-form-urlencoded;charset=utf-8

请求说明:

名称 必填 类型 说明 示例参数另存

appid 是 String 应用ID,在后台我的应用查看或者添加 1

bank_card 是 Integer 银行卡卡号 6222600260001072444

bank_name 是 String 开户名,即身份证上名字 张三

format 否 String 返回数据格式类型,每个接口已经说明支持返回格式:json,xml, jsonp调用方法说明 json

sign 是 String 1.使用Md5方式验证,参数按一定规则md5后返回的字符串,详情点击这里阅读

2.使用Hash验证方式,直接跟上密钥即可。如何设置hash验证

通过我的应用里面修改验证方式 52a9dbe274a5c537bbf7a53e2d66c09f

Md5验证方式-加密顺序

sign = MD5( appid1bank_card6222600260001072444bank_name张三formatjson密钥) 查看加密规则说明 密钥不需要键名,请直接跟上32位的密钥

红色部分代表参数值,appid默认为1,请修改为自己的appid值,去我的应用查看以及密钥

*注意:空值不参与加密。

返回参数说明:

名称 必填 类型 说明 示例参数另存

bank_card 是 Integer 银行卡卡号 6212264100043510829

bank_msg 否 String 消息说明 一致

bank_name 是 String 开户名,即身份证上名字 李**

bank_status 否 String 返回的状态码,详情点击这里查看 01

codeid 否 Integer 状态码,返回10000状态都会进行计费。具体说明可查看状态码说明 10000

message 否 String 请求状态说明 查询成功

retdata 否 Array 回数据集合,可能是数据、对象或者字符串

time 否 String 请求时传递的当前服务器时间戳 1597907528

JSON返回示例:

树 ▾

object►retdata►

复制代码
object		{4}

codeid : 10000

message : 查询成功

复制代码
retdata		{4}

bank_name : 李**

bank_card : 6212264100043510829

bank_status : 01

bank_msg : 一致

time : 1597907528

相关推荐
冰_河4 分钟前
QPS从300到3100:我靠一行代码让接口性能暴涨10倍,系统性能原地起飞!!
java·后端·性能优化
桦说编程3 小时前
从 ForkJoinPool 的 Compensate 看并发框架的线程补偿思想
java·后端·源码阅读
躺平大鹅5 小时前
Java面向对象入门(类与对象,新手秒懂)
java
初次攀爬者5 小时前
RocketMQ在Spring Boot上的基础使用
java·spring boot·rocketmq
花花无缺6 小时前
搞懂@Autowired 与@Resuorce
java·spring boot·后端
Derek_Smart7 小时前
从一次 OOM 事故说起:打造生产级的 JVM 健康检查组件
java·jvm·spring boot
NE_STOP8 小时前
MyBatis-mybatis入门与增删改查
java
孟陬11 小时前
国外技术周刊 #1:Paul Graham 重新分享最受欢迎的文章《创作者的品味》、本周被划线最多 YouTube《如何在 19 分钟内学会 AI》、为何我不
java·前端·后端
想用offer打牌11 小时前
一站式了解四种限流算法
java·后端·go